Polyguard Launches PG-Presence for True Physical Verification
On August 7, 2025, Polyguard unveiled its latest innovation, PG-Presence™, a cutting-edge solution against deepfakes and AI-driven fraud. At the heart of this initiative lies the proprietary PG-Presence™ method, designed to ensure individuals are indeed present during verification processes. Inspired by techniques from GPS-based network security, this technology confirms the user's physical presence in front of their device, drastically reducing the risk of identity fraud. Available for both iOS and Android platforms, this feature uniquely positions Polyguard as the first provider of such robust fraud prevention across the two dominant mobile ecosystems.
In response to escalating concerns surrounding digital impersonation and fabricated media, Polyguard has expanded its infrastructure significantly. The company now operates in key regions including India, Southeast Asia, and South America, with localization efforts featuring support for English, Spanish, and Hindi languages. This global expansion reflects Polyguard's commitment to offering enterprises a reliable and privacy-conscious way to verify identities.
One of the critical updates is the full-offline verification capability for ePassports, utilizing Near Field Communication (NFC) technology. This means users can confirm their identity without any internet connection, safeguarding sensitive data by ensuring it remains on the device. This breakthrough is particularly important for users with government-issued ePassports, ensuring that verification processes do not compromise individual privacy or data security.
